John Hancock, one of the largest Long TermCare insurance (LTCi) carriers, recently released its findings on which areas cost the most (and least) for actual care. The report's based on a survey of some 16,000 providers across the US of A to come up with community averages.

Here's a sampling of what they found:

1. Nursing home: Private room

Cheapest: Jefferson City, Missouri ($142 per day)

Most expensive: Juneau, Alaska ($600 per day)

4. Home health aide

Cheapest: Fort Lauderdale, Florida ($15 per hour)

Most expensive: Minneapolis ($31 per hour)

5. Adult day care

Cheapest: Montgomery, Alabama ($22 per day)

Most expensive: New York ($203 per day)
